Injector seals 035 906 149A, cheap source

New here, so I don't know if this is the best place to put this, but I just made a discovery that could save members some cash.

Part number 035 906 149A is apparently something over £3 each genuine. It's an o-ring 7.52mm x 3.53, and made of Viton, to the best of my knowledge, which is pretty good at thermal and chemical resistance (as reqd for an injector seal!).

I have no connection with this company, but simplybearings.co.uk will sell you a pack of 10 of these for £7.62 delivered. Here's a link for you: http://simplybearing...oduct_info.html

On my 3-cyl. AZQ engine there's two of these o-rings per injector, so a pack of 10 gives 4 spares. Prices for packs of 5 and 2 work out more in total unless you only have 1 or 2 seals that you want to change.

Nice thing to have in the 'spares box' TBH, even if you don't have an immediate plan to get involved with your injectors.

Hope this helps someone. If anyone knows of any reason why these ones aren't suitable replacements for genuine, please add to this thread.

 

Edit: Since posting this I've bought and used these on my Golf, with no problems.
